Transaction 5261bf83135b75f71c8eb7c3568a845b45a28509c075f659eab5e7184d2bf886

2 Input
2 Outputs
  • 5261bf83135b75f71c8eb7c3568a845b45a28509c075f659eab5e7184d2bf886:0
  • value  1321
    address  15qiYPJ45wUyvqKCmfdSt65tr8L2hwCsSR
  • 5261bf83135b75f71c8eb7c3568a845b45a28509c075f659eab5e7184d2bf886:1
  • value  813674
    address  192CuFTZakFSWP2JWy5FWG4HBf4hQ2GMZM